Nomura Securities maintains a 'Buy' on Time Warner Cable (NYSE: TWC) price target of $100.00 (from $90.00).
Analyst, Mike McCormack, said, "Time Warner Cable increased the pace of share repurchases during the quarter, returning ~115% of fully taxed free cash flow, and increased the rate further in July. We are raising our outlook for 2013 share repurchases by $500mn to $2bn due to strong cash flow performance, and before the use of the $950mn in after-tax SpectrumCo proceeds...Subscriber growth lagged our and consensus expectations, as well as the strong results posted by Comcast. We raised our estimates for Business and Advertising revenue, but this was offset by a reduction in Residential. Advertising was also strong, with the benefit of the political cycle yet to come. We estimate 12% EBIT growth and an EPS of $5.77, up from our prior $5.57 estimate, with the driver being lower interest expense as the company continues to refinance debt at lower rates."
3Q12E EPS from $1.49 to $1.52; 4Q12E from $1.57 to $1.62; FY12E from $5.57 to $5.67
